A shaft assembly includes a shaft, a nut, a nut lock ring and a tubular nut support ring. The shaft includes a nut base mounted on the shaft, and a plurality of protrusions that extend radially out from the nut base. Adjacent protrusions are circumferentially separated by a gap. The nut lock ring includes a tubular ring base connected axially between a plurality of first lock tabs and a plurality of second lock tabs. The ring base is disposed on the nut base. Each first lock tab extends radially inward through a respective one of the notches. Each second lock tab extends axially through a respective one of the gaps. The nut support ring is disposed on the ring base.

1. A shaft assembly, comprising: a shaft comprising a plurality of notches that extend axially into an end thereof;a spanner nut comprising a nut base and a plurality of protrusions, wherein the nut base is mounted on the shaft, the protrusions extend radially out from the nut base, and adjacent protrusions are circumferentially separated by a gap;a nut lock ring comprising a tubular ring base connected axially between a plurality of first lock tabs and a plurality of second lock tabs, wherein the ring base is disposed on the nut base, each first lock tab extends radially inward through a respective one of the notches, and each second lock tab extends axially through a respective one of the gaps; anda tubular nut support ring disposed on the ring base. 2.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the nut support ring comprises an outer radial support ring surface that extends, substantially parallel to a centerline of the shaft, between a first support ring end and a second support ring end. 3.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the nut support ring extends axially between a first support ring end and a second support ring end, and an inner radial edge of at least one of the support ring ends comprises an eased geometry. 4.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ein each first lock tab comprises an axially extending first base tab segment and a radially extending first end tab segment, wherein the first base tab segment is connected between the ring base and the first end tab segment, and wherein the first end tab segment extends through the respective notch. 5. The shaft assembly of claim 4, wherein the ring base comprises a nut contact segment that contacts the nut base, and the nut contact segment comprises a nut contact segment thickness that is less than a base tab segment thickness of the first base tab segment. 6.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ein each second lock tab comprises a second base tab segment and a second end tab segment, the second base tab segment extends axially between the ring base and the second end tab segment, the second end tab segment extends through the respective gap, and the second end tab segment is canted radially outwards relative to the second base tab segment. 7.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the nut lock ring is manufactured from a length of tube stock. 8.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the nut lock ring is manufactured from sheet metal. 9.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the nut support ring is manufactured from a length of tube stock. 10.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the nut support ring is manufactured from sheet metal. 11. The shaft assembly of claim 1, wherein the shaft comprises an engine shaft for a gas turbine engine. 12. The shaft assembly of claim 11, further comprising a rotor disc mounted on the shaft, wherein the nut axially secures the rotor disc onto the shaft. 13. A shaft assembly, comprising: a shaft comprising a plurality of notches that extend axially into an end thereof;a nut comprising a nut base and a plurality of protrusions, wherein the nut base is mounted on the shaft, the protrusions extend radially out from the nut base, and adjacent protrusions are circumferentially separated by a gap;a nut lock ring comprising a tubular ring base connected axially between a plurality of first lock tabs and a plurality of second lock tabs, wherein the ring base is disposed on the nut base, each first lock tab extends radially inward through a respective one of the notches, and each second lock tab extends axially through a respective one of the gaps; anda tubular nut support ring disposed on the ring base;wherein the nut lock ring further comprises a third lock tab connected to the ring base, wherein the third lock tab extends radially outward, and the nut support ring is disposed axially between the third lock tab and the second lock tabs. 14. The shaft assembly of claim 13, wherein the third lock tab is disposed circumferentially between two respective first lock tabs. 15. A shaft assembly, comprising: a shaft comprising a plurality of notches that extend axially into an end thereof;a nut comprising a nut base and a plurality of protrusions, wherein the nut base is mounted on the shaft, the protrusions extend radially out from the nut base, and adjacent protrusions are circumferentially separated by a gap;a nut lock ring comprising a tubular ring base connected axially between a plurality of first lock tabs and a plurality of second lock tabs, wherein the ring base is disposed on the nut base, each first lock tab extends radially inward through a respective one of the notches, and each second lock tab extends axially through a respective one of the gaps; anda tubular nut support ring disposed on the ring base;wherein the shaft further comprises a threaded shaft segment, and the nut base comprises a threaded nut bore that is mated with the threaded shaft segment. 16. A shaft assembly, comprising: a shaft comprising a plurality of notches that extend axially into an end thereof;a nut comprising a nut base and a plurality of protrusions, wherein the nut base is mounted on the shaft, the protrusions extend radially out from the nut base, and adjacent protrusions are circumferentially separated by a gap;a nut lock ring comprising a tubular ring base connected axially between a plurality of first lock tabs and a plurality of second lock tabs, wherein the ring base is disposed on the nut base, each first lock tab extends radially inward through a respective one of the notches, and each second lock tab extends axially through a respective one of the gaps; anda tubular nut support ring disposed on the ring base;wherein the shaft further comprises a retainer flange that extends radially inward at the end of the shaft, and a retaining ring is disposed axially between the retainer flange and at least one of the first lock tabs to axially secure the nut lock ring onto the nut.
